I wound up staying in one of the Paiza suites (floors 50-54) and those are by far the finest hotel in Singapore. Truly Peninsula quality, both in service level and quality of furnishings. The rest of the hotel is presumably not like that at all (normally Paiza is not bookable, I think, it is probably for whales). Not only is there butler service, but room service is close to instantaneous (ordering food and a bucket of ice results in 2 people bringing the items separately, for example, to ensure faster service). Private elevators just for these floors, so never a long wait (the hotel has 2500 rooms, so elevators are bound to be a bottleneck for regular rooms). I was charged USD 1000 per night for a huge suite (guess over 2000 sq. ft.) and this includes all drinks 24x7 though alcoholic is just 2 hours per day (but unlimited and includes things like Martell Cordon Bleu and Dom). This thread really belongs in Luxury hotel forum, at least this part of the hotel would make the top 20 luxury hotels in the world list and have a shot at top spot! I expected little, and wound up getting a lot.

Even for regular club rooms, the rooftop pool, park and club combo is stunning, as are the public spaces and shopping. I wasn't wanting to shop, but there is maybe the world's largest Luis Vuitton store there, as well as excellent Chanel, Prada, Hermes, etc. stores. And good prices, at least for high-end goods.
